I have a 1996 960 sedan. 123K miles.

The indicator lights on the buttons for Winter/Wet and Economy drive modes are flashing back and forth, consistently, nonstop.

On the dash, the Winter/Wet indicator light (up arrow) is on, constantly (NOT flashing).

Does anyone have any idea what this means? Any help would be greatly appreciated.

I had this on my 1991 960. Gave me quite a start as I found out that the ECU had decided to go into 'limp home' mode. I read the fault code and then erased it. I kept the car another three years, it never came back and the car ran like a dream. My tame Volvo technician could not explain the cause but said he had seen it before and, in his experience, it usually only happened once in the life of the car.

On yours it will be OBD11 so I suggest you go to Autozone, or somewhere similar, have the codes read and, if they will, have it erased. Then see what happens.
